#e70f01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e70f01 is composed of 90.6% red, 5.9%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 99.6%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 45.5%. #e70f01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1e02 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#e70f01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e70f01 has RGB values of R:231, G:15,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:1,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15142657.

Shades and Tints of #e70f01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100100 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e70f01
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6d6c is the less saturated color, while #e70f01 is the most saturated one.
